zoukankan      html  css  js  c++  java
  • mysql添加用户和密码

    1.新建用户。
    #foo表示你要建立的用户名,后面的123表示密码, #localhost限制在固定地址localhost登陆 CREATE USER foo@localhost IDENTIFIED BY '123';

    #创建数据库并指定字符编码
    CREATE SCHEMA `database_name` DEFAULT CHARACTER SET utf8mb4 COLLATE utf8mb4_unicode_ci ;
    2.为用户授权。
    
    
     
    
    
    //登录MYSQL(有ROOT权限)。我里我以ROOT身份登录.
    
    
    @>mysql -u root -p
    
    
    @>密码
    
    
    //首先为用户创建一个数据库(phplampDB)
    
    
    mysql>create database phplampDB;
    
    
    //授权phplamp用户拥有phplamp数据库的所有权限。
    
    
    >grant all privileges on phplampDB.* to phplamp@localhost identified by '1234';
    
    
    //刷新系统权限表
    
    
    mysql>flush privileges;
    
    
    mysql>其它操作
    
    
     
    
    
    /*
    
    
    如果想指定部分权限给一用户,可以这样来写:
    
    
    mysql>grant select,update on phplampDB.* to phplamp@localhost identified by '1234';
    
    
    //刷新系统权限表。
    
    
    mysql>flush privileges;
    
    
    */
    
    
     
    
    
    3.删除用户。
    
    
    @>mysql -u root -p
    
    
    @>密码
    
    
    mysql>DELETE FROM user WHERE User="phplamp" and Host="localhost";
    
    
    mysql>flush privileges;
    
    
    //删除用户的数据库
    
    
    mysql>drop database phplampDB;
    
    
     
    
    
    4.修改指定用户密码。
    
    
    @>mysql -u root -p
    
    
    @>密码
    
    
    mysql>update mysql.user set password=password('新密码') where User="phplamp" and Host="localhost";
    
    
    mysql>flush privileges;
     
  • 相关阅读:
    Kafka之消费者与消费者组
    Kafka之生产者
    基于Redis+Lua的分布式限流
    限流方案常用算法讲解
    分布式服务限流
    微服务框架服务调用与容错
    ZooKeeper实现服务注册中心
    微服务注册中心
    让我自己来整理
    Netty框架
  • 原文地址:https://www.cnblogs.com/shengpengsp/p/14034339.html
Copyright © 2011-2022 走看看